Can You Use Cleaning Solution with ILIFE W400?
Manufacturer Recommendations
The cleaning system in the ILIFE W400 is based on water only; the appliance fills its water tank to keep the cleaning pads moist for mopping. Therefore, the manufacturer usually recommends the use of only plain water with the robot to prevent any possible damage to the flooring or robot itself.
Compatibility with Cleaning Solutions
Although cleaning solutions are not officially approved by the manufacturer to be used with the ILIFE W400, a few users have done some testing with adding very mild cleaning solutions to the water tank to remove old stains or to just enhance the cleaning process. Nevertheless, it is very important that one proceeds very carefully while using cleaning solutions because some substances might be incompatible with the robot’s parts or might leave the floor dirty with residues.
Risks and Considerations
In advance to the cleaning solutions being applied with the ILIFE W400, it is very crucial to think about the following risks and factors:
Damage to Components: Some cleaning solutions have acid, that may cause the robot’s internal components or the materials from which it is made to rot or suffer from sullying.
Residue Build-Up: Gradually, the residues that some cleaning solutions produce on the floor or the robot’s cleaning pads might lead to streaks, smudges, or even reduced cleaning efficiency as well.
Warranty Voidance: By using cleaning solutions not approved by the manufacturer, you are changing the usage of the ILIFE W400, and it might result in the warranty being voided, leaving you with the responsibility for any damages or malfunctions.
Recommended Cleaning Solutions
While using ILIFE W400, if cleaning solutions are to be experimented with, the user should always opt for mild, non-abrasive, and floor-safe solutions. The following could be a few of the recommended options:
Mild Floor Cleaners: These are cleaners that are specifically designed for hard floors like tile, laminate, or hardwood among others.
Neutral pH Cleaners: Cleaners with neutral pH will not be able to damage the surfaces or leave the residues.
Eco-Friendly Formulations: The environmentally friendly cleaners are made with no harsh chemicals or fragrances, thus they are safer for both the robot and the environment.
It is a must to always dilute cleaning solutions according to the manufacturer’s instructions and perform a patch test in an inconspicuous area before the use of the same with the ILIFE W400.

Best Practices for Using Cleaning Solutions with ILIFE W400
Dilution
Dilute cleaning solutions strictly according to the manufacturer’s directions prior to pouring them into the ILIFE W400’s water tank. The use of undiluted solutions might result in the accumulation of residues, the occurrence of streaking, or even the damage of the robot’s parts.
Patch Testing
Use of a cleaning solution together with the ILIFE W400 should be preceded by performing patch testing in a hidden spot to check for compatibility with the flooring surface and to assess any negative reactions, such as discoloration or damage.
